Candida overgrowth is a condition where the yeast naturally present in the body multiplies uncontrollably, with a high-sugar diet being a major contributing factor. This overgrowth can create an intense, persistent feedback loop, causing you to crave the very sugars that feed the yeast. It is not merely a lack of self-control, but rather a complex biological interaction.

Historically used for centuries as a natural remedy for wounds, honey possesses inherent antimicrobial properties. However, when considering internal Candida overgrowth versus topical infections, the question of "can honey help yeast" becomes complex, as research indicates certain types of honey have powerful antifungal effects but should be used with caution.
